An alien parasite once latched on to another moutainous alien; The combined being took the name Overmaster and journeyed through space, interfering with sentient worlds. When this being arrived on Earth, it saw a planet full of super heroes and recognised a new way to test the populace. Overmaster recruited 6 humans and formed the Cadre. This group challenged the Justice League to battle with the fate of humanity at stake. The JLA prevailed. Overmaster returned for man's "Judgement Day" and again faced the League.

It is not known how long he has wandered the cosmos before arriving at Earth, but along the way he accumulated many alien prisoners, many of whom are the last of their race, including Yazz.